Marty Carr speaks to Adam Maguire on RTE’s Radio 1

Marty Carr, CEO Carr Golf speaks to Adam Maguire on RTE’s Radio 1 on behalf of the Ireland Golf Tour Operators Association (IGTOA), and calls on the government for further financial support for the industry into 2021.
The golf travel industry (IGTOA members) handled €325m in 2019, now suffers its second year of little to no revenue. The industry relies heavily on international visitors, tough times are set to continue until international travel is allowed to resume.
